Is there room to negotiate?
A typical listing stays on the market for about 20 days — this one has been up for 14 days. 1.7% of active listings have cut their asking price in the last 90 days. Asking prices per m² are about 1.4% higher than a month ago.
Observed asking prices – not transaction prices or a valuation.

This single-family house in Strengelbach convinces with a generous plot of land, a natural environment, and a view over the agricultural area. Whether as a charming home, renovation project, or for new ideas, numerous possibilities open up here.
Highlights of the property
The main train station Zofingen can be reached in about 8 minutes by bike, the motorway access in about 12 minutes by car. Shopping facilities and public transport are in the immediate vicinity.
